Glu-Glu Tag Polyclonal Antibody, AbBy Fluor™ 350 Conjugated

Product Specifications

Background

Glu-Glu Tag is a commonly used epitope tag engineered onto the N- or C- terminus of a protein of interest so that the tagged protein can be analyzed and visualized.Because of the small size of the epitope, it is unlikely to alter the activity of the cloned sequence.

Synonyms

EYMPME epitope tag; EYMPME tag; Glu-Glu epitope tag.
